It expresses Zhao Ji’s wish to pray for good luck to the emperor. There are also a few exotic grasses growing on the rocks. Emperor Huizong of the Song Dynasty regarded the appearance of such strange stones and herbs as auspicious omens for the national destiny of the Song Dynasty, and praised them as "auspiciousness". In his opinion, doing all he could to draw auspicious signs was the best way to pray for the national destiny and boost morale. Best means.
